Fun facts. Coca-Cola is one of the most popular drinks in the world. It is estimated that 1.9 billion servings of Coca-Cola are consumed every day. This equates to more than 60 billion servings annually. Coca-Cola products are sold in over 200 countries. Coca-Cola’s overall revenue in 2020 was 33.01 billion U.S. dollars, while PepsiCo’s revenue was 70.37 billion U.S. dollars. Coca-Cola sold about 418.4 billion litres of carbonated beverages in 2020, while Pepsi sold 310 billion litres. The bottle was trademarked in 1961 — an unusual move for product packaging, but one that made sense for the distinct bottle. The bottle is now called the "contour bottle" after a 1925 French magazine article that used the phrase. The glass bottle is not used for classic American Coke as often, as cans and plastic bottles have become the norm. Coca-Cola introduced the 7.5-ounce mini-can in 2009, and on September 22, 2011, the company announced price reductions, asking retailers to sell eight-packs for $2.99. That same day, Coca-Cola announced the 12.5-ounce bottle, to sell for 89 cents.
